Annual data
| Year | Gross MarginValue |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| 24.6% | -7.2% |
| FY2024 | 26.5% | +5.5% |
| FY2023 | 25.1% | +23.4% |
| FY2022 | 20.3% | -10.9% |
| FY2021 | 22.8% | -23.5% |
| FY2020 | 29.8% | +2.7% |
| FY2019 | 29.0% | +9.6% |
| FY2018 | 26.5% | - |
